If you’ve taken a Pilates class, you probably know what all of the aforementioned means. But if you haven’t, well you now have a chance to attend one of the most anticipated Pilates studio openings Columbus has seen.
Pilates by Ashtyn Studio officially opens this Thursday, October 16th. The Italian Village studio, located at 1146 N. 4th St., is the largest studio in the entire state, and most importantly, it’s really chic.
Owner and instructor Ashtyn Pharis has been teaching for over 12 years, and she wanted to create a space that’s not only fully hers, but yours, too. Expect intentional, calming energy, curated playlists, new equipment, an uplifting environment, and occasionally a visit by her three adorable dogs.
“We’re here for mindful movement, music that moves you, and a space that feels like yours the moment you walk in. This is where control meets flow. Structure meets sweat. Rest meets resistance. Whether you’re in your first class or your hundredth, you’ll leave feeling stronger in your body and clearer in your head,” says Pilates by Ashtyn’s website.
Besides the gorgeous interior, Pilates by Ashyn is different from most other studios in that it offers reformer and mat classes. “We’re committed to true Pilates,” they said. “Authentic training, not ‘inspired’ trends, brought to life in a space designed for community and growth.”
